Build Kotlin Chat App like WhatsApp in Android Studio 2024

Learn Kotlin, Firebase Android Chat App like Facebook Messenger | Telegram Application with Firebase Cloud Messaging FCM

3.65 (63 reviews)
Udemy
platform
English
language
Mobile Apps
category
instructor
Build Kotlin Chat App like WhatsApp in Android Studio 2024
361
students
8 hours
content
Feb 2024
last update
$59.99
regular price

What you will learn

Kotlin Chat App with Firebase

Firebase Database

Firebase Authentication

Firebase Cloud Messaging for real time Push Notifications

Firebase Storage

Why take this course?

In this course you will learn how to create android real time chat app using Kotlin programming language with firebase authentication, firebase real time database, firebase storage, firebase cloud messaging , firebase cloud messaging for real time push notifications.

At the end of this course, you will be able to develop your large android projects using android studio.


Kotlin is a cross-platform, statically typed, general-purpose programming language with type inference. Kotlin is designed to interoperate fully with Java, and the JVM version of Kotlin's standard library depends on the Java Class Library, but type inference allows its syntax to be more concise.


Firebase is a platform developed by Google for creating mobile and web applications. It was originally an independent company founded, Google acquired the platform and it is now their flagship offering for app development.


Firebase Cloud Messaging (FCM) is a cross-platform messaging solution that lets you reliably send messages at no cost. It works on the principle of down streaming messages from FCM servers to user's app and upstream messages from user's apps to FCM servers. Firebase comes with a lot of new features along with the GCM infrastructure.


Android Studio is the official integrated development environment for Google's Android operating system, built on JetBrains' IntelliJ IDEA software and designed specifically for Android development.

Screenshots

Build Kotlin Chat App like WhatsApp in Android Studio 2024 - Screenshot_01Build Kotlin Chat App like WhatsApp in Android Studio 2024 - Screenshot_02Build Kotlin Chat App like WhatsApp in Android Studio 2024 - Screenshot_03Build Kotlin Chat App like WhatsApp in Android Studio 2024 - Screenshot_04

Reviews

Leonardo
July 3, 2022
This course is very good, it teaches in a simple and intuitive way how to create an android application, step by step
Eliran
January 26, 2022
First of all, thank you for making this course, it did help me a bit. The review: So the design looks good and the idea is great and interesting. I think it could be done so much better. The app is looking good, however, built in a fragile way. I would use some android architecture, because the code is very messy and hard to read. I noticed not once that just at the end of the lesson you run the app to test it, and it's very hard to follow like this, especially when you don't always explain what you are doing. Your mic volume is very low and many times I didn't understand what you are saying and couldn't follow… Overall I did learn a lot because of the problems I had to solve when converting the code to MVVM, And because the app touches many subjects it's a good practice, so thank you :)
Avinash
September 21, 2020
Excellent course, follow Mr. Ali step by step and you will have a working app. Small bugs might happen but they can be sorted out. Thanks for an excellent course. Would have liked additional content on storing firebase content locally and not online as large read write access means charges.
Ahame
July 17, 2020
There are allot of issues with this app and they are not addressed at all while the coarse develops. Also, Android Studios makes allot of assumptions as to what your intent is and if yours does not match, it crashes. The instructor never clarifies which path he is taking so you are left having to trial and error and do allot of debugging while doing the coarse.
Ayush
July 9, 2020
The entire code is hefty and full of un-resolvable errors, poor implementation, outdated dependencies, poor xml formatting of tags and attributes, incomplete references of libraries, all a total sum of non-working application at the end
Euclides
May 9, 2020
This course is really good! However, it's still unclear how to add contacts to the contacts list and writing comments above each function or complicated piece of code would make it perfect.
Chandan
April 27, 2020
Doesn't explain things as he goes so you kinda keep wondering why he did some things the way he did. Not very organized either. I felt the need to go online and search for several things to understand what he was doing on screen and, more importantly, why? Most of the code he writes also doesn't work. You will need to spend a lot of time Googling to find out how to fix errors. Also, the coding style is full of errors and redundant code. Finally, although not related to the course, you can see he uses uTorrent to download pirated stuff, like Need For Speed game, which you can see in his downloads folder. Etics aside, this is not something a "teacher" would do.
Robert
April 8, 2020
i just love your each and every course Coding Cafe, because after watching your courses now i am a complete developer. i learned many things from your courses, thank you so so much.

Charts

Price

Build Kotlin Chat App like WhatsApp in Android Studio 2024 - Price chart

Rating

Build Kotlin Chat App like WhatsApp in Android Studio 2024 - Ratings chart

Enrollment distribution

Build Kotlin Chat App like WhatsApp in Android Studio 2024 - Distribution chart
2909374
udemy ID
3/25/2020
course created date
4/4/2020
course indexed date
Bot
course submited by